About the University of Georgia :

Chartered by the state of Georgia in 1785, the University of Georgia is the birthplace of public higher education in America and is the state’s flagship university (https : / / www.uga.edu / ) . The proof is in our more than 240 years of academic and professional achievements and our continual commitment to higher education. UGA is currently ranked among the top 20 public universities in U.S. News & World Report. The University’s main campus is located in Athens, approximately 65 miles northeast of Atlanta, with extended campuses in Atlanta, Griffin, Gwinnett, and Tifton. UGA employs approximately 3,100 faculty and more than 7,700 full-time staff. The University’s enrollment exceeds 41,000 students including over 31,000 undergraduates and over 10,000 graduate and professional students. Academic programs reside in 19 schools and colleges, including our newly established School of Medicine.

    Duties / Responsibilities :

  • Develop and execute the mission, vision, and strategic direction for the new UGA School of Nursing.
  • Lead the accreditation process to ensure regulatory compliance and approval with the goal of enrolling the first UGA class of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) students in fall 2027. This effort will include curriculum design, development, and approval, including, as appropriate, alignment with the American Association of Colleges of Nursing’s (AACN) Essentials; Georgia Board of Nursing (GBON) approval;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education (CCNE) approval; SACSCOC accreditation; and NCLEX-RN requirements
  • Attract and retain students, enrolling an initial undergraduate junior-year cohort of roughly 60 students and expanding in the years following the charter class.
  • Establish a Master of Science in Nursing (MSN), a Doctor of Nursing Practice (DNP), and research-oriented Ph.D. programs in nursing to train future nurse educators andresearchers.
  • Understand the needs of programs across undergraduate and graduate levels to advance the success of all students.
  • Oversee all School operations and personnel, including recruiting new full-time, part-time, and adjunct faculty, administrators, and staff; developing the School’s bylaws, policies, and committee structure for appointment, evaluation, promotion, tenure, and governance, consistent with University System of Georgia and UGA policies and procedures; and establishing and managing the budget, including during the school’s formation before credit-hour revenue has been realized.
  • Establish external partnerships and agreements with clinical training sites in Athens and surrounding areas and identify opportunities for other partnerships that advance the University’s mission, leveraging UGA’s land-grant and extension identity and presence throughout the state of Georgia through Health Extension programming, the Clinical and Translational Science Alliance, and other community engagement programs.
  • Cultivate relationships with state and community partners, supporters, donors, and public officials as needed to establish and grow the new School, including but not limited to generating public and / or private financial and non-financial support for the School.
  • Clearly communicate the School’s vision and mission to internal and external audiences.
  • Establish the new School’s presence within the nursing academy, serving as the primary representative of the School of Nursing at the national level, and build and maintain relationships with public, corporate, and non-governmental organizations in the nursing field to advance the mission of the School.
  • Promote collaborations and interprofessional education opportunities with other academic disciplines, including leveraging UGA’s newly founded School of Medicine and broader health sciences expertise, including the College of Public Health, College of Pharmacy, School of Social Work, College of Family and Consumer Sciences, and comprehensive One Health portfolio, with life sciences, plant sciences, medical sciences, and veterinary medicine.
